Mercy Pomeroy 1684–1712 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 20 Sept 1684

Birth Location: Northampton Hampshire Massachusetts USA

Death Date: 17 Apr 1712

Death Location: ,Northampton,Hampshire Co,MA

Father: Caleb Sr

Mother: Hepzibah Baker

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

In 1684, Mercy Pomeroy entered the world in Northampton Hampshire Massachusetts USA, born to Caleb Pomeroy Sr And Hepzibah Baker. Mercy Pomeroy passed away in 1712 in ,Northampton,Hampshire Co,MA.
